    Le phosphate de dihydrogène de lithium (
    L i H 2 P O 4 cap L i cap H sub 2 cap P cap O sub 4
    𝐿 𝑖 𝐻 2 𝑃 𝑂 4
    , CAS 13453-80-0) de qualité industrielle est un composé chimique inorganique essentiel, principalement utilisé comme additif dans la fabrication de matériaux de cathode pour batteries lithium-ion (type LFP) . Présenté sous forme de poudre, il améliore la densité énergétique et la stabilité thermique. Il trouve également des applications dans les verres/céramiques, la synthèse chimique et comme stabilisant.
    Caractéristiques principales :
    • Formule :
      L i H 2 P O 4 cap L i cap H sub 2 cap P cap O sub 4
      𝐿 𝑖 𝐻 2 𝑃 𝑂 4
      (CAS : 13453-80-0).
    • Pureté : Généralement proposée à 97% ou plus pour un usage industriel, avec des formes haute pureté disponibles pour la recherche.
    • Propriétés : Solide cristallin blanc, parfois légèrement hygroscopique.
    • Utilisations :
      • Batteries Li-ion : Préparation du phosphate de fer lithié (
        L i F e P O 4 cap L i cap F e cap P cap O sub 4
        𝐿 𝑖 𝐹 𝑒 𝑃 𝑂 4
        ) pour les cathodes.
      • Industrie : Additif pour céramiques et verres spéciaux, améliorant la résistance thermique.
      • Catalyse : Réactif/catalyseur en synthèse chimique.
    • Stockage : Doit être conservé dans un endroit frais, sec et bien ventilé, dans un emballage hermétique pour éviter l'absorption d'humidité.
